When looking for urban planter boxes, you might wonder whether to visit your local garden center or order online. Both options have their advantages. Local garden centers allow you to see and touch the planters, assess quality firsthand, and get immediate expert advice. You can check drainage holes, material durability, and size suitability for your balcony or patio right away. However, their selection might be limited, especially for specific styles or larger quantities.
Ordering online offers a vast range of designs, materials, and sizes, often at competitive prices. You can compare numerous brands, read customer reviews, and have items delivered to your door. The downside includes potential shipping costs, delivery wait times, and the inability to inspect products before purchase. For unique or custom designs, online retailers typically provide more options. Consider your priorities: if you need planters quickly and prefer personal inspection, a local center is ideal. For broader selection and convenience, online shopping may be better. Many gardeners combine both, buying basics locally and specialty items online.
